Enzyme Inhibition
In living organisms, shuttle intermediate compounds along directed pathways,enzymes catalyze reactions, and provide control over biological procedures. Whether animal, bacteria, plant, or virus, enzymes are must for life. Enzymes are also of extreme medicinal interest, for most of the drugs prescribed are enzyme inhibitors.
